Kuchar Electric designs and builds electrical distribution systems. In the past 15 years we have averaged twelve power trailers per year without outside sales support. The demand in Colorado for quality installations prompted us to develop a switchgear manufacturing facility and market them nationally. We own a 9000 square foot electrical shop and have partnered with Kendo Corporation, a metal fabrication facility for mechanical support. Kuchar Electric has three designers and computer aided design for documentation. Our experience in the maintenance and service field has developed a sound, top quality product with standard features and application design that are proven to work in the rugged rock-mining environment.

Typically, we modify used reefer semi trailers to house a genset, an MCC, and an operator cabin.

The generator room is kept separate from the electrical room by a wall with a door. This reduces noise and dust. The genset room has louvers built into the side of the trailer, sized to keep the genset cool with the proper CFM of air. Because of vibration, the genset is wired via seal tight to EMT conduit into the MCC main.

The electrical room has motor controls mounted along the wall. The starters are wired through the floor to an underslung gutter that houses the motor receptacles. We also quote the plugs for the field cord. We run conduit and pull control wire (120VAC) from the starters to the operator's console. The MCC's have a built in panel board for 120 VAC utility power. The utilities consist of fluorescent lights, light switches and electrical outlets throughout the trailer.

The office, or operator cabin in outfitted with an operator console. The console has a start button, a stop button, a motor run pilot light, and an emergency stop button to shut down the system immediately upon the operator's discretion. An alarm horn, which is also controlled through the operator console, warns employees of a system start-up. The operator cabin has air conditioning, heating and three large windows to overlook your spread. The windows are DOT safety glass and have a 3-degree tilt toward the bottom to prevent dust build up. Kuchar Electric can also supply a pop up operator cabin on request, this cabin has the same features but also uses hydraulics to raise and lower the cabin, the benefit being a better field of view.
